Wyatt is a social, playful three-year-old boy who comes to us originally from Tennessee! He was found in a barn with his mother, Whitney, and sister, Willow. Wyatt loves people and will be absolutely thrilled to see any of them! He loves to go to the state park for a quick jump in the pond. He is an excellent car rider and will let you fashion him to a seat belt so he can ride in style! Wyatt also loves the vet and will be a star whenever he goes due to his love for anyone he meets. He's a sweet, loving dog!



Wyatt has lived with older children and done well, but may jump on the little ones and any strangers he's excited to see. While Wyatt has resided with other animals, he is looking for a pet-free home at this time, as he holds his toys, home and food near and dear to his heart! Wyatt will thrive in a high-energy home with lots of mental stimulation and things to do. He'll love any chance you give him for exercise, so he's a great running buddy!



Wyatt has been crate-trained and quite enjoys spending time in his little den, and will likely benefit from being crated during times someone cannot be home, as he does tend to have wandering paws when he gets bored! He is completely housebroken. He knows his basic commands of come, sit, stay, paw, other paw, down, and up. He absolutely loves to learn, play, and just generally be a dog! If you're looking for a sweet, loving, high-energy dog, Wyatt would be a great addition to your pet-free home.

Their adoption process

Additional adoption info

We thoroughly screen all potential adopters. We require an adoption application, phone interview, personal and vet references, in-person interview with home visit, and then signed adoption contract and fee. We do our best to complete the adoption process within seven days.

Our adoption fee is $500 for dogs and $200 for cats

More about this rescue

Survivor Tails Animal Rescue is a 501c3, non-profit, all-volunteer organization that exists to rescue, rehome, and rehabilitate homeless, unwanted, abused, and neglected dogs and cats and place them in loving and responsible forever homes. More than 4 million cats and dogs die each year in animal shelters across the country due to overpopulation issues. That's why we're here. Our mission is twofold: to find these unwanted animals loving homes of their own and to work with communities and like-minded organizations to stop the issue of overpopulation from the top. We don't want to just put a bandage on the issue, we want to prevent animal homelessness from the getgo.
